Market Overview

The juice industry encompasses a wide range of products, including fruit juices, vegetable juices, blends, and cold-pressed juices. These products are typically marketed as natural, nutritious, and refreshing options for consumers looking to improve their overall health and well-being.

One of the key drivers of growth in the juice industry is the increasing awareness of the health benefits of consuming fresh fruits and vegetables. Juices are often touted for their high levels of v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ants, making them a popular choice among individuals looking to boost their immune system, improve digestion, and increase energy levels.

Another factor contributing to the growth of the juice industry is the rise of juice bars and specialty juice shops. These establishments offer consumers a wide variety of fresh, made-to-order juices that cater to specific health goals or dietary preferences. With the rise of social media and influencer culture, these juice bars have become popular destinations for health-conscious individuals looking for photogenic and Instagram-worthy beverages.

Market Trends

One of the key trends shaping the juice industry is the demand for cold-pressed juices. Cold-pressed juices are made using a hydraulic press that extracts juice from fruits and vegetables without exposing them to heat, which can destroy some of the nutrients and enzymes present in the produce. Cold-pressed juices are often marketed as being more nutrient-dense and fresher than traditional juices, making them a popular choice among consumers looking for the healthiest options available.

Another trend in the juice industry is the rise of functional beverages. Functional beverages are beverages that contain added ingredients, such as probiotics, antioxidants, or adaptogens, that are believed to provide specific health benefits. These beverages are often marketed as being more than just a refreshing drink, but as a functional and targeted solution for various health concerns.

Market Challenges

While the juice industry is experiencing growth and innovation, it also faces several challenges. One of the key challenges is the high level of competition in the market. With an increasing number of juice brands and products entering the market, companies must find ways to differentiate themselves and stand out from the competition.

Another challenge facing the juice industry is the perception of juice as a high-sugar and calorie-dense beverage. While natural fruit juices contain vitamins and minerals, they can also be high in sugar, which has led some consumers to be wary of consuming them regularly. Companies in the juice industry must find ways to address these concerns and educate consumers about the benefits of consuming juice in moderation.
